Abstract
Humans have advanced skills that enable them to sense and interact with their physical surroundings however, the majority of our interaction with digital information does not take advantage of our haptic channel and mental state and is still mainly confined to one device. This might be explained because the development of interactive systems that effectively support users' tasks execution taking into consideration additional human senses or mental state is more challenging. In this talk, I will present several efforts towards improved user interaction by highlighting some of the works I am involved in including the use of haptics and physiological data for improved robot teleoperation and a framework for rapid prototyping of ubiquitous computing environments.
